INGREDIENTS

–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– 5 cups rough chopped sweet yellow onion
– 2 Thai chilis, chopped fine
– 5 cups fresh corn (about 8 ears) OR 5 cups frozen corn OR mix (5 cups total)
– 1 medium russet potato, sliced thin (so it cooks quickly)
– 4 teaspoons Thai yellow curry paste
– ¼ teaspoon turmeric (optional for enhanced color)
– 1 can unsweetened coconut milk
– 5 cups chicken stock
– 5 tablespoons fish sauce
– 2 teaspoons sugar
– 2 tablespoons lime juice
– Salt to taste

Garnishes:

radishes sliced into sticks
chopped cilantro
lime wedge
dollop of crème fraiche
Thai hot sauce

Servings: 15 people, 3/4 cup per person

Instructions

– Cut the corn kernels from the cobs, transfer to a bowl
– In a large stockpot over medium heat, heat olive oil. Add onion and Thai chilis, and sauté, stirring occasionally until soft and fragrant, 3-5 minutes. Add corn kernels (fresh &/or frozen), potato, Thair curry paste, turmeric (if using) to the pot, and sauté until corn is soft, about 3 minutes more.
– Add coconut milk, chicken stock, fish sauce and sugar. Bring to a bowl, then reduce to simmer, cover and cook for 20 minutes.
– Use an immersion blender to roughly puree the soup, so that it’s creamy but still has some kernels of corn and chunks of potato. Alternative, put half of the soup in a blender and blend until smooth and return to the pot.
– Season with lime juice and salt and mix to combine.
– Ladel soup and add garnishes.

Notes: This recipe originated from Davis Estates (in Napa Valley), and was adapted to pair with Spicy’s Sauvignon Blanc.  The original recipe did not include Thai chilis in the soup, or lime, crème fraiche and Thai hot sauce garnishes. The original recipe called for 2 Kaffir lime leaves added with step 3 ingredients, but leaves can be hard to find so additional lime was added to the garnish.
